#![allow(unused)]
use std::os::raw::{c_char, c_int, c_uint, c_void};
use std::slice;
pub type FFICallBack = unsafe extern "C" fn(c_int, *const c_char, usize, *const c_void);
unsafe extern "C" {
pub fn waku_new(
config_json: *const c_char,
cb: FFICallBack,
user_data: *const c_void,
) -> *mut c_void;
pub fn waku_start(ctx: *mut c_void, cb: FFICallBack, user_data: *const c_void) -> c_int;
pub fn waku_stop(ctx: *mut c_void, cb: FFICallBack, user_data: *const c_void) -> c_int;
pub fn waku_version(ctx: *mut c_void, cb: FFICallBack, user_data: *const c_void) -> c_int;
pub fn set_event_callback(ctx: *mut c_void, cb: FFICallBack, user_data: *const c_void);
pub fn waku_relay_publish(
ctx: *mut c_void,
cb: FFICallBack,
user_data: *const c_void,
pubsub_topic: *const c_char,
json_message: *const c_char,
timeout_ms: c_uint,
) -> c_int;
pub fn waku_relay_subscribe(
ctx: *mut c_void,
cb: FFICallBack,
user_data: *const c_void,
pubsub_topic: *const c_char,
) -> c_int;
pub fn waku_connect(
ctx: *mut c_void,
cb: FFICallBack,
user_data: *const c_void,
peer_multi_addr: *const c_char,
timeout_ms: c_uint,
) -> c_int;
pub fn waku_get_my_peerid(ctx: *mut c_void, cb: FFICallBack, user_data: *const c_void)
-> c_int;
pub fn waku_start_discv5(ctx: *mut c_void, cb: FFICallBack, user_data: *const c_void) -> c_int;
pub fn waku_stop_discv5(ctx: *mut c_void, cb: FFICallBack, user_data: *const c_void) -> c_int;
pub fn waku_get_my_enr(ctx: *mut c_void, cb: FFICallBack, user_data: *const c_void) -> c_int;
pub fn waku_discv5_update_bootnodes(
ctx: *mut c_void,
cb: FFICallBack,
user_data: *const c_void,
bootnodes: *const c_char,
) -> c_int;
}
pub unsafe extern "C" fn trampoline<C>(
return_val: c_int,
buffer: *const c_char,
buffer_len: usize,
data: *const c_void,
) where
C: FnMut(i32, &str),
{
if data.is_null() {
return;
}
let closure = unsafe { &mut *(data as *mut C) };
if buffer.is_null() || buffer_len == 0 {
closure(return_val, "");
return;
}
let bytes = unsafe { slice::from_raw_parts(buffer as *const u8, buffer_len) };
let buffer_str = String::from_utf8_lossy(bytes);
closure(return_val, &buffer_str);
}
pub fn get_trampoline<C>(_closure: &C) -> FFICallBack
where
C: FnMut(i32, &str),
{
trampoline::<C>
}
pub const RET_OK: i32 = 0;
